Default Adding a reference under VBA

Greetings !

And, having copied this sheet into a new workbook, how do
I then add to the new workbook a Reference to the old
workbook ?

I can do it manually, but I can't record my steps as a
Macro.

Default Adding a reference under VBA

Explain how you do it manually - then we might have a better idea of what
you exactly mean by reference.

If you mean a reference added in Tools=References in the VBE,

http://support.microsoft.com/?id=160647
XL97: How to Programmatically Create a Reference

http://support.microsoft.com/?id=156882
XL97: Err Msg: "Name Conflicts with Existing Module"
